import * as Core from 'cloudflare/core';
import { APIResource } from 'cloudflare/resource';
import * as HealthchecksAPI from 'cloudflare/resources/healthchecks/healthchecks';
import * as PreviewsAPI from 'cloudflare/resources/healthchecks/previews';
import { SinglePage } from 'cloudflare/pagination';
export declare class Healthchecks extends APIResource {
previews: PreviewsAPI.Previews;
/**
* Create a new health check.
*/
create(params: HealthcheckCreatePar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.APIPromise<Healthcheck>;
/**
* Update a configured health check.
*/
update(healthcheckId: string, params: HealthcheckUpdatePar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.APIPromise<Healthcheck>;
/**
* List configured health checks.
*/
list(params: HealthcheckListPar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.PagePromise<HealthchecksSinglePage, Healthcheck>;
/**
* Delete a health check.
*/
delete(healthcheckId: string, params: HealthcheckDeletePar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.APIPromise<HealthcheckDeleteResponse>;
/**
* Patch a configured health check.
*/
edit(healthcheckId: string, params: HealthcheckEditPar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.APIPromise<Healthcheck>;
/**
* Fetch a single configured health check.
*/
get(healthcheckId: string, params: HealthcheckGetParams, options?: Core.RequestOptions): Core.APIPromise<Healthcheck>;
}
export declare class HealthchecksSinglePage extends SinglePage<Healthcheck> {
}
export interface Healthcheck {
/**
* Identifier
*/
id?: string;
/**
* The hostname or IP address of the origin server to run health checks on.
*/
address?: string;
/**
* A list of regions from which to run health checks. Null means Cloudflare will
* pick a default region.
*/
check_regions?: Array<'WNAM' | 'ENAM' | 'WEU' | 'EEU' | 'NSAM' | 'SSAM' | 'OC' | 'ME' | 'NAF' | 'SAF' | 'IN' | 'SEAS' | 'NEAS' | 'ALL_REGIONS'> | null;
/**
* The number of consecutive fails required from a health check before changing the
* health to unhealthy.
*/
consecutive_fails?: number;
/**
* The number of consecutive successes required from a health check before changing
* the health to healthy.
*/
consecutive_successes?: number;
created_on?: string;
/**
* A human-readable description of the health check.
*/
description?: string;
/**
* The current failure reason if status is unhealthy.
*/
failure_reason?: string;
/**
* Parameters specific to an HTTP or HTTPS health check.
*/
http_config?: Healthcheck.HTTPConfig | null;
/**
* The interval between each health check. Shorter intervals may give quicker
* notifications if the origin status changes, but will increase load on the origin
* as we check from multiple locations.
*/
interval?: number;
modified_on?: string;
/**
* A short name to identify the health check. Only alphanumeric characters, hyphens
* and underscores are allowed.
*/
name?: string;
/**
* The number of retries to attempt in case of a timeout before marking the origin
* as unhealthy. Retries are attempted immediately.
*/
retries?: number;
/**
* The current status of the origin server according to the health check.
*/
status?: 'unknown' | 'healthy' | 'unhealthy' | 'suspended';
/**
* If suspended, no health checks are sent to the origin.
*/
suspended?: boolean;
/**
* Parameters specific to TCP health check.
*/
tcp_config?: Healthcheck.TcpConfig | null;
/**
* The timeout (in seconds) before marking the health check as failed.
*/
timeout?: number;
/**
* The protocol to use for the health check. Currently supported protocols are
* 'HTTP', 'HTTPS' and 'TCP'.
*/
type?: string;
}
export declare namespace Healthcheck {
/**
* Parameters specific to an HTTP or HTTPS health check.
*/
interface HTTPConfig {
/**
* Do not validate the certificate when the health check uses HTTPS.
*/
allow_insecure?: boolean;
/**
* A case-insensitive sub-string to look for in the response body. If this string
* is not found, the origin will be marked as unhealthy.
*/
expected_body?: string;
/**
* The expected HTTP response codes (e.g. "200") or code ranges (e.g. "2xx" for all
* codes starting with 2) of the health check.
*/
expected_codes?: Array<string> | null;
/**
* Follow redirects if the origin returns a 3xx status code.
*/
follow_redirects?: boolean;
/**
* The HTTP request headers to send in the health check. It is recommended you set
* a Host header by default. The User-Agent header cannot be overridden.
*/
header?: unknown | null;
/**
* The HTTP method to use for the health check.
*/
method?: 'GET' | 'HEAD';
/**
* The endpoint path to health check against.
*/
path?: string;
/**
* Port number to connect to for the health check. Defaults to 80 if type is HTTP
* or 443 if type is HTTPS.
*/
port?: number;
}
/**
* Parameters specific to TCP health check.
*/
interface TcpConfig {
/**
* The TCP connection method to use for the health check.
*/
method?: 'connection_established';
/**
* Port number to connect to for the health check. Defaults to 80.
*/
port?: number;
}
}
